Jeddah (JED) to Ronne (RNN) Flight Distance

The flight distance from King Abdulaziz International Airport (JED) in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ia to Bornholm Airport (RNN) in Ronne, Denmark is 4,231 kilometers (2,629 miles / 2,284 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 6h, flying north northwest at a heading of 337°.
